如上程序,我對(duì)數(shù)組te排序了。但是我又要用到?jīng)]有排序的數(shù)組y,但是程序的結(jié)果是y也排序了。有什么方法嗎?
問題解決:利用concat方法,實(shí)現(xiàn)了數(shù)組的拷貝。
后記:這種方式的確實(shí)現(xiàn)了將數(shù)據(jù)庫中動(dòng)態(tài)數(shù)據(jù)以圖表形式顯示在頁面上。程序以javascript實(shí)現(xiàn),利用ajax將實(shí)現(xiàn)更好的用戶體驗(yàn)。這樣做減輕了服務(wù)端的壓力。不過,這種方式的確定是客戶端變得龐大。而且其實(shí)現(xiàn)原理很恐怖,基本是div實(shí)現(xiàn)點(diǎn)陣字原理(一點(diǎn)點(diǎn)畫上去的)來搞的。效率就顯得不夠快。不過我在項(xiàng)目用這中方式也做完一個(gè)項(xiàng)目了。呵呵,和原來用jfreechart比較,感覺jfreechart (當(dāng)然完全可以利用cewolf來簡(jiǎn)化操作)不爽的地方是他總是先生成圖。然后利用src來顯示的。其實(shí)效率也不怎么高。不過服務(wù)器好的話,客戶端就輕松。無非就是胖客戶端和胖服務(wù)器的比較,立場(chǎng)都不同了。
